Output d301dee6e717b08b29590b57786d4f5a9d2a5c985ceed8990047556c8299f020:2

value
18948503
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ccd26f1a9d699294348e54d70ff76b35767e3ffd OP_EQUALVERIFY OP_CHECKSIG
address
1KfzwLxMv8R1Kg9Xr1tdbQcEba8GQ8qDo1
transaction
d301dee6e717b08b29590b57786d4f5a9d2a5c985ceed8990047556c8299f020
confirmations
367521
spent
true